> In HDFS-8319 [~jingzhao] raised some issues about ByteBuffer type
> input/output buffers for raw erasure coders:
> * Should support ByteBuffers originated from {{ByteBuffer#slice}} calls;
> * Should clearly spec in Javadoc that no mixing of on-heap buffers and direct
> buffers are allowed, and with necessary checking codes ensuring the same type
> of buffers are used.
> In HDFS-8319 patch by [~jingzhao] there are some good refactoring codes that
> would be incorporated here.
> As discussed open this to address the issues separately.
